Local Area - The small but busy Market Town of Long Sutton has a good range of amenities including Co-Op Store/Post Office, Tesco One-Stop, Boots Pharmacy, Health Centre, Opticians, Library, Hardware Store, Appliance Store, Dentists, Hairdressers, Various Eateries and Shops. The market is held every Friday in Market Place. The larger towns of Kings Lynn and Spalding are both approximately 13 miles away and have ongoing coach and rail links direct to London and the North. The North Norfolk coast is just a 45-minute drive. The smaller nearby town of Sutton Bridge also offers a small Marina, a challenging Golf Course along with the Sir Peter Scott Walk.
